Since discussing the Rongdi King's marriage with Xiao Aiyue, Zhao Xuan and Gu Zhanghua could only calm down and wait for news, hoping that some kind and righteous girl would take the initiative to propose a marriage alliance with the Rongdi tribe.
Little did they know that as soon as Consort Shu announced the news of the marriage alliance, it was like a tornado, sending chaos into the backyards of every mansion.
why?
Because the ladies of the various mansions were unwilling to send their pampered young ladies to the northern grasslands, which they considered like lambs to the slaughter.
Dancing with wolves? That's just a legend!
Not only was the environment harsh, but the Rongdi tribes were all barbarians in their eyes, and the Rongdi king was the barbaricest of all barbarians!
The young lady, whom you've raised with so much care and effort, might be tortured to death just two days after getting married!
This is no exaggeration. The North has been plagued by war for many years, and even women in the inner quarters have heard about it.
One person tells ten, ten tell a hundred, you add a little imagination, he adds a little hearsay, marriage alliances with Rong and Di tribes, it sounds nice, but what's the difference between that and sending them to their deaths?
The ladies preferred to marry their daughters off to distant lands, as long as it was within the territory of Xia, and they didn't care if the family was poor, since they could afford a generous dowry.
The legitimate daughter is definitely out of the question. If His Majesty forces a marriage, the illegitimate daughters born to concubines can be used as scapegoats.
But none of the concubines and illegitimate daughters were easy to deal with. They cried and wailed in front of the master and his wives every day, and they all said the same thing: if they were to be married off to the Rongdi tribe, they would rather find a white silk ribbon and end their lives as soon as possible.
As a result, paper became scarce in Liyang City, and matchmakers became highly sought after by various mansions, receiving generous rewards. They would immediately give a reward for any match they agreed to, and double the reward if the match was successful.
Young men walking down the street suddenly realized they were being targeted by kidnappers, with countless greedy eyes staring at them from all angles.
For men who are unmarried, there are noble ladies willing to marry into lower social classes; for men who are married, there are innocent girls eager to become their concubines.
Suddenly, there were no rules or regulations governing marriages in Liyang City.

The General's Mansion.
Qin Chuyun's boudoir.
Wu Yulan and Qin Chuyun sat at the table. She was both the mistress of the General's Mansion and Qin Chuyun's stepmother. Qin Shao only had this one daughter.
Qin Shao is constantly fighting against the Rongdi tribes in the northern border, and Qin Chuyun has no chance of marrying into the Rongdi king, but what if he does?
Therefore, Wu Yulan, without exception, immediately sought out a matchmaker upon hearing the news and obtained firsthand information.
At this moment, she was facing a booklet on the table, turning to a page, patiently explaining to Qin Chuyun one by one the suitable marriage candidates.
"...So, I still think that the third son of Vice Minister Liu of the Ministry of Revenue is the best match for you. You are not one to meddle in things, so you don't need to be the mistress of the house in the future. Just manage the affairs of your own courtyard after you marry in!"
Wu Yulan's mouth was dry from talking, so she picked up her teacup, took a sip, and continued speaking.
"Liu Dachuan is only three years older than you, which is a suitable age. Moreover, he is already a squad leader in the Imperial Guard and is highly trusted by His Majesty. He is considered a member of the military, so he and our family are well-matched!"
After a long and enthusiastic discussion, Wu Yulan looked up at Qin Chuyun with great interest.
She was heartbroken over this daughter who wasn't her own, and hoped that Qin Chuyun would understand her good intentions and agree to the marriage.
If things don't settle down soon, Liu Dachuan will soon be snatched away by other women.
By then, there will be fewer and fewer unmarried women of marriageable age, and it's possible that the task of arranging a marriage alliance with the Rong and Di tribes will fall to Qin Chuyun.
That would be terrible!
If Qin Shao were to blame her, Wu Yulan knew she couldn't bear the consequences. If things went wrong, she, who had been the matriarch of the General's Mansion for many years, might have to step down sooner or later!
But Wu Yulan never expected that after all her earnest advice, what was Qin Chuyun doing?
Qin Chuyun rested his chin on his hands, staring blankly at the jujube tree outside the window.
Did you hear what I just said?!
Wu Yulan's anger flared up instantly. She reached out and poked Qin Chuyun's forehead, her voice filled with rage.
"Huh? Oh...I heard that..."
Qin Chuyun's perfunctory reply infuriated Wu Yulan even more.
"What did you hear? If you really heard it, I'll have a matchmaker come over in a bit and finalize your marriage with Liu Dachuan!"
Qin Chuyun finally gave Wu Yulan a reaction. She sat up straight, looking unwilling, and shook her head like a rattle drum.
"Young lady, I won't marry anyone!"
One sentence sealed the deal, and the conversation died.
"you!"
Wu Yulan was so furious that she wanted to faint immediately, hoping she would never see this stubborn girl again in her life.
But there was nothing he could do. Qin Chuyun was Qin Shao's darling. Qin Shao could ignore his wife, but he always smiled gently whenever he saw his daughter.
For Qin Shao's sake, Wu Yulan suppressed her anger.
"If you don't marry the person I chose for you, who do you want to marry? Do you really want to marry that Rongdi king? Didn't you hear what the ladies in the various mansions were saying? Barbarians, they have no ethics or morals. It's only natural for a brother to marry his sister-in-law when his elder brother dies..."
Qin Chuyun closed the booklet on the table and handed it to Wu Yulan.
"Seeing is believing, hearing is deceiving; sometimes what you see with your eyes may not be the truth."
Qin Chuyun didn't mean to speak well of the Rongdi King; he simply didn't want to continue the topic.
"Little sister, Sister Xuan and her husband returned a couple of days ago. I want to go see them."
This interruption reminded Wu Yulan of the matter.
For the past two days, Qin Chuyun had been insisting on going to the Prince Xian's residence. She was worried that the two of them would have to go to the palace to meet the emperor again and manage the affairs of the residence. She was afraid that Qin Chuyun would cause trouble if she went there, so she had not agreed.
She must be almost done with her work by now, so it wouldn't hurt to have Qin Chuyun go over there. She's worried about the two children, so it would be a good opportunity for Qin Chuyun to visit them on her behalf.
Wu Yulan stuffed the booklet back into Qin Chuyun's hands.
"You can go, but take this list with you and have your sister Xuan and brother-in-law help you choose. See if I'm right!"
"Fine!"
Qin Chuyun had no choice but to back down and accept the booklet, but she had no intention of discussing it with her sister Xuan and brother-in-law. She threw the booklet away halfway there, deciding to end it all.
Wu Yulan breathed a sigh of relief when she saw that Qin Chuyun agreed without saying a word.
Xuan'er's words carried more weight than her mother's, and Xuan'er genuinely cared for Qin Chuyun and would definitely plan a good marriage for him.
Moreover, Xuan'er and the Prince Xian have just returned from the Northern Border Army, and they must know the Rongdi King better. They certainly won't let Qin Chuyun act willfully and recklessly, nor will they allow Qin Chuyun to have any possibility of marrying the Rongdi King.
Thinking of this, Wu Yulan smiled and her voice softened considerably.
"Wait a minute before going. I'll cook some of your sister Xuan's favorite pastries right now. Could you take them to her for me? Tell her I have a lot of chores to do at home today, and I'll visit her in a couple of days, or invite her to come over to visit in a couple of days."
Qin Chuyun agreed to all of them.
As long as she could leave this lifeless general's mansion and her nagging, demanding mother-in-law marry her off immediately, she would agree to any request.
It wasn't that she didn't want to get married, but that she didn't want to end up like her stepmother, whose heart and soul were completely devoted to her father, while her father remained indifferent to her stepmother.
She's grown tired of seeing this over the years. She knows her mother is suffering, and she feels sorry for her.
She didn't want to marry a man who wouldn't cherish her.
She wants to learn from her sister Xuan and her brother-in-law, to find someone she loves and who will be her lifelong partner.
She didn't recognize any of the men in the booklet.
Why would I marry?!
